Key Facts

  • Newmark awarded exclusive leasing for a 4.2 million-square-foot portfolio.
  • The portfolio includes office and flex spaces in Suburban Philadelphia.
  • Newmark aims to stabilize the assets and capture tenant demand.
  • Occupancy rates are strong: 85% in Chester County, 92% in Horsham.
  • Improvement in leasing momentum indicated in Greater Philadelphia's office market.
